AI-Driven Query Optimization Techniques as a Predictor of Database Systems Performance among Database Administrators in Federal Universities in South-South, Nigeria

The purpose of this study was to determine the influence of influence of AI-driven query optimization techniques as predictors of database systems performance among Database Administrators in Federal Universities in South-South Nigeria. Two specific objectives were identified, two research questions were raised and two null hypotheses were formulated to guide this study. The study adopted a descriptive survey design and was conducted in the South-South geopolitical zone of Nigeria. The population of the study was 58 Database Administrators. The total population of 58 Database Administrators was used as a sample size because the population was in a manageable size and purposive sampling technique was used. The researcher developed thirty (30) items research instrument titled “AI-Driven Query Optimization Techniques Questionnaires” (AIDQOTQ) for data collection. The instrument was subjected to face validation. The researcher with the aid of one research assistants who were briefed on the purpose of this study administered the 58 copies of questionnaire to the respondents at various institutions. Out of 58 copies of questionnaire distributed, 54 copies were returned with valid data. This gave a response rate of 93.10 percent and the attrition rate of 6.9 percent. Linear regression analysis was used to answer the research questions and also test null hypotheses at 0.5 level of significance. The findings of the study revealed that AI-Driven query optimization techniques had a strong positive influence on database systems performance among Database Administrators in Federal Universities in South-South Nigeria. It was further revealed that the ANOVA results indicated that predictive query optimization, automated index recommendation and adaptive query processing techniques had a statistically significant influence on database systems performance among Database Administrators in Federal Universities in South-South Nigeria. Based on the finding of this study, it was concluded that AI-driven query optimization techniques play a significant role in enhancing database systems performance among Database Administrators in Federal Universities in South-South Nigeria. Specifically, predictive query optimization, automated index recommendation and adaptive query processing techniques were found to have strong positive and statistically significant influences on database systems performance. Based on the conclusion, it was recommended that Database Administrators in Federal Universities in South-South Nigeria should adopt and effectively utilize AI-driven query optimization techniques to improve database performance.
